Man dead after crashing into Beall’s department store in St. Petersburg

St. Petersburg police is investigating a fatal crash into the back of a shopping center at 7899 MLK St. N.

At about 2:16 p.m. on Saturday, February 1, 2020, a minivan drove into the back of the Bealls department store.

The driver, Mladen Kravarusic, was the only one in the 2013 Dodge Grand CaravanĀ and he died at the scene. Police stated that Kravarusic was traveling west on 79th Terrace North at a high rate of speed.

For an unknown reason, he drove through the rear parking lot, into the rear wall of Bealls Department Store.

No one else was injured inside the store.

The Bealls store was closed due to the damage
